9. Elizabeth Taylor

Elizabeth Taylor

Few Hollywood stars had a romantic history as famous as Elizabeth Taylor. The legendary actress married eight times during her life, making her relationships a permanent part of Hollywood history.

Her most famous romance was undoubtedly with Richard Burton. The pair married twice and divorced twice, creating a relationship filled with passion, arguments, reconciliations and enormous media attention. Taylor's marriages and relationships reflected the larger-than-life personality that made her one of Hollywood's most enduring stars.

6. Ava Gardner

Ava Gardner

Ava Gardner was one of classic Hollywood's most celebrated stars, and her romantic life was almost as legendary as her acting career. Her relationships included famous figures such as Mickey Rooney, Artie Shaw, Howard Hughes and Ernest Hemingway.

Her marriage to Frank Sinatra became particularly famous. The relationship was intensely passionate and frequently covered by the press. Although their marriage ended, Sinatra remained an important figure in Gardner's life. Her glamorous image and string of famous relationships helped cement her reputation as one of Hollywood's great screen icons.

1. Mae West

Mae West

Mae West stands out as one of the earliest Hollywood women to openly challenge conventional ideas about female sexuality and independence. She was an actress, writer and performer who built her career around provocative humor and fearless self-expression.

West repeatedly challenged censorship and conservative attitudes, even facing legal trouble over some of her work. Rather than backing away from controversy, she turned it into part of her brand and became one of the highest-paid entertainers of her era.

Her personal life was also unconventional for the period. She was known for relationships with men of different ages and refused to conform to the expectations placed on women at the time. One famous story claims that when her partner William Jones faced discrimination at the building where she lived, West purchased the property and removed the restriction.

Whether every detail of that story has been embellished over the years or not, it perfectly captures the rebellious spirit associated with Mae West. Long before modern celebrities openly discussed independence and personal freedom, she had already made a career out of refusing to play by society's rules.
